DEPARTMENT OF BIOCHEMISTRY

  1. About the department:

Department of Biochemistry is committed to provide competency based education to students, high quality diagnostic services to patients and to conduct high quality research.

Students of I-MBBS, Paramedical and Nursing are taught Biochemistry to understand molecular basis of life in health and disease. It helps to understand disease mechanisms. Academic activities include theory classes, practical classes, tutorials, seminars, group discussions, integrated teaching and periodic assessment of the students.

Laboratory diagnostic services have become more important than ever, for the clinician to arrive at a diagnosis. They form the cornerstone of healthcare. Department of Biochemistry offers diagnostic services round the clock, supporting the clinicians with wide range of investigations and panel of tests. HIMS lab is the only NABL Accredited Laboratory amongst all Karnataka Govt Medical College Hospitals

Research activities are integral component of our department. Departmental staff members are actively involved in research and have published more than 18 articles in various national and international scientific journals and presented papers in various conferences.

Department is well equipped with a research laboratory, undergraduate practical halls, demonstration rooms, seminar hall, and a departmental library which has updated text books and reference books for the use of faculty and Undergraduate students.

The department’s clinical Biochemistry section is equipped with fully automated analyzers, semi-automated analyzers, electrolyte analyzers etc to evaluate organ profiles for the right diagnosis, monitor patient compliance and outcome of treatment.

  1. Services Provided:

At College:

Undergraduate teaching for I-MBBS students, Paramedical students, and Nursing students.

PG Teaching: MD Biochemistry students are trained in clinical laboratary, Research Methodology, and undergraduate teaching.

At Hospital Laboratory:

HIMS Lab is the only NABL Accredited Laboratory amongst all Karnataka Govt Medical College Hospitals.

It ensures Assured Quality Reports to patients and a Great Exposure to Biochemistry PG students. Laboratory Diagnostic services are provided round the clock to patients of HIMS Teaching hospital and Sri Chamarajendra Hospital.
